
Spinach Artichoke Dip Stuffed Mushrooms (video)
BARS = SHARE OF RECIPE CALORIES · RINGS = FDA DV
Mushroom caps filled with creamy spinach and artichoke dip, then topped with a parmesan breadcrumb crust and baked until tender and golden. An elegant, easy appetizer that feels impressive.

Ingredients
serves 8- 1 pound whole white mushrooms ((about 2 inches wide))
- 1 cup wilted spinach ((5 ounces fresh - see note))
- ⅓ cup plain fat free greek yogurt (OR light mayo (I like to use a combination of both))
- 2 ounces cream cheese (softened)
- ⅓ cup shredded par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on minced garlic
- ¼ teaspoon Italian seasoning
- 1 cup chopped artichoke hearts
- salt and pepper to taste ((I use about ½ teaspoon salt and ¼ teaspoon black pepper))
- ¼ cup breadcrumbs
- 3 tablespoons shredded parmesan cheese
- ½ teaspoon Italian seasoning
